Hi ProLV

Thanks for your messages. We are not so concerned with exactly what content, navigation, links etc as we are looking for designers who can come up with a general concept first, then we can work on those things. However, to help we make the following points:
- this is not a booking website so no need for a booking engine
- the site will display new hotels only (1 - 12 months old) so it is necessary to somehow highlight this
- the site should categorise hotels by (a) age and (b) region - Asia, America etc
- we have asked for 2 pages (a) homepage and (b) 2nd page - ie. when you click on a hotel from the homepage. the homepage should be very simple and just show hotel, name, age, region and somehow provide a way for users to sort through hotels (ie. left to right etc). the 2nd page has more content as it will list a single hotel with images, a general description, reviews, a link to the hotel website, and an area to feature special prices if any (which are offered by the hotel directly). 
- only other links required would be basics like: about us, privacy, previous hotels (ie. those listed more than 12 months ago), and a twitter link.
